Maxine M. Lawson

Full Name: Maxine M. Lawson Age: 82 Years

Current address: Topeka

Date of death: July 7, 2003

Place of death: Topeka

Date of birth: January 10, 1921 Place of birth: Quenemo, KS

Parents: John Thomas and Gladys Sutton Plowman

Years in current city/town: life-long resident

Background: graduated valedictorian of the class of 1939, Melvern High School. Was employed by Capper Publications and Stauffer Communications from 1944 until her retirement in 1986.

Relatives: Married to: Harold Lawson on December 24, 1945 in Topeka, KS.

preceded in death by: her husband, Harold Lawson in 1993; and her sister, Imogene Cuffel in 1998.
